Fonction somme si

Fermé
salekreo Messages postés 1 Date d'inscription mercredi 13 avril 2016 Statut Membre Dernière intervention 13 avril 2016 - 13 avril 2016 à 21:10
Frenchie83 Messages postés 2240 Date d'inscription lundi 6 mai 2013 Statut Membre Dernière intervention 11 août 2023 - 14 avril 2016 à 05:37
Bonjour

Au départ dans mon fichier excel j’avais 138 lignes et un certain nombre de colonne et j’utilisais cette formule :
=SI($J$11="";SOMME(SI(('Prévision agro & budget 16 -17'!$A$2:$A$138=C13);'Prévision agro & budget 16 -17'!$AJ$2:$AJ$138))/SOMME(SI(('Prévision agro & budget 16 -17'!$A$2:$A$138=C13);'Prévision agro & budget 16 -17'!$E$2:$E$138));(1+$J$11)*SOMME(SI(('Prévision agro & budget 16 -17'!$A$2:$A$138=C13);'Prévision agro & budget 16 -17'!$AJ$2:$AJ$138))/SOMME(SI(('Prévision agro & budget 16 -17'!$A$2:$A$138=C13);'Prévision agro & budget 16 -17'!$E$2:$E$138)))
Je viens d’ajouter 8 lignes , ce qui me donne 146 ligne, le remplacement dans cette de 138 par 146 me donne :
#DIV/0!

Comment faire et comment reformuler ?
Je vous remercie e d’avance de votre aide

2 réponses

Raymond PENTIER Messages postés 58719 Date d'inscription lundi 13 août 2007 Statut Contributeur Dernière intervention 7 novembre 2024 17 233
Modifié par Raymond PENTIER le 13/04/2016 à 21:26
 1) Tu vas dans https://www.cjoint.com/ 
2) Tu cliques sur [Parcourir] pour sélectionner ton fichier (8192 Ko maxi)
3) Tu défiles vers le bas pour cliquer sur le bouton bleu [Créer le lien Cjoint]
4) Au bout de quelques secondes la deuxième page s'affiche, avec le lien en gras ; tu le sélectionnes et tu fais "Copier"
5) Tu reviens dans ta discussion sur CCM, et dans ton message de réponse tu fais "Coller".
=>Voir la fiche https://www.commentcamarche.net/faq/29493-utiliser-cjoint-pour-heberger-des-fichiers
Sans fichier, on ne peut pas faire grand-chose ...
C'est bien, la retraite ! Surtout aux Antilles ... :-) 
Raymond (INSA, AFPA, CF/R)
0
Frenchie83 Messages postés 2240 Date d'inscription lundi 6 mai 2013 Statut Membre Dernière intervention 11 août 2023 338
14 avril 2016 à 05:37
Bonjour Salekreo, Bonjour Raymond
On peut proposer ceci
Remplacez 'Prévision agro & budget 16 -17'!$A$2:$A$138 par
INDIRECT("'Prévision agro & budget 16 -17'!A2:A"&NBVAL('Prévision agro & budget 16 -17'!$A$2:$A$1000)+1)
Remplacez 'Prévision agro & budget 16 -17'!$AJ$2:$AJ$138 par
INDIRECT("'Prévision agro & budget 16 -17'!AJ2:AJ"&NBVAL('Prévision agro & budget 16 -17'!$A$2:$A$1000)+1)
Remplacez 'Prévision agro & budget 16 -17'!$E$2:$E$138 par
INDIRECT("'Prévision agro & budget 16 -17'!E2:E"&NBVAL('Prévision agro & budget 16 -17'!$A$2:$A$1000)+1)

Remplacez 1000 par une autre valeur s'il doit y avoir plus de 1000 lignes.
A tester
Cdlt
0